Field Service Engineer - New Jersey

JOB TITLE: 

Field Service Engineer - New Jersey

 

JOB DESCRIPTION: 

The Field Service Engineer is responsible for the installation, repair, retrofitting, deinstallation, and training of Heller ovens. The role requires providing high-level technical support, including troubleshooting complex system issues, performing in-depth diagnostics, and offering tailored solutions to ensure optimal system performance and reliability for customers. This involves analyzing technical problems, identifying root causes, and implementing effective repairs or adjustments to maximize equipment uptime. The engineer will also work closely with customers to ensure that all systems are running efficiently, meeting operational standards, and delivering long-term reliability. Due to customer requirements, the candidate must be a US citizen and capable of passing a federal background check. When not traveling, this position is on-site in the company’s Florham Park, NJ headquarters facility.
